SQLRU.net
Разработка приложений баз данных

Начало » Использование СУБД » Firebird, HQbird, InterBase » fbclient.dll (Как правильно обновить на клиенте?)
fbclient.dll [сообщение #5955] Tue, 04 March 2025 22:15 Переход к следующему сообщению
sg729 в настоящее время не в онлайне  sg729
Сообщений: 64
Зарегистрирован: June 2022
Member
На сервере установлен LI-V3.0.12.33787 Firebird 3.0, устанавливался из:
https://github.com/FirebirdSQL/firebird/releases/download/v3 .0.12/Firebird-3.0.12.33787-0.amd64.tar.gz
Цитата:
root@ubtest:/usr/local/bin# /opt/firebird/bin/gbak -z
gbak:gbak version LI-V3.0.12.33787 Firebird 3.0
На клиенте (Windows 10 x64) был fbclient.dll версии 3.0.11.33703 и с ним клиент прекрасно работал с базой на сервере.

Попробовал обновить fbclient.dll на клиенте до версии 3.0.12.33787 - скопировал fbclient.dll, msvcp100.dll, msvcr100.dll из :
https://github.com/FirebirdSQL/firebird/releases/download/v3 .0.12/Firebird-3.0.12.33787-0-x64.zip
в папку с клиентской прогой (там же лежали файлы для версии 3.0.11.33703).
При запуске клиентской проги получаю ошибку :
Цитата:
System Error. Code 193.
%1 не является приложением Win32
В чем моя ошибка?

Re: fbclient.dll [сообщение #5956 является ответом на сообщение #5955] Tue, 04 March 2025 23:54 Переход к предыдущему сообщению
sg729 в настоящее время не в онлайне  sg729
Сообщений: 64
Зарегистрирован: June 2022
Member
Понял, надо было брать fbclient.dll из 32-х разрядной версии
https://github.com/FirebirdSQL/firebird/releases/download/v3 .0.12/Firebird-3.0.12.33787-0-Win32.zip
клиентская прога 32-х разрядная.
Предыдущая тема: Ненужные сканы записей при rows
Следующая тема: Engine13 exists but can not be loaded
Переход к форуму:
  


Текущее время: Fri Mar 07 01:13:12 GMT+3 2025

Общее время, затраченное на создание страницы: 0.00915 секунд